Thought you might like this picture of the runs on a old stock car on
the old World of Mirth Shows in 1958. I really don`t believe I`d be driving that
tractor down these. The stock car was originally on the Tim McCoy Wild West Show
and later on Cole Bros Circus before coming to WOM.
